> Good Morning-
> Early this morning, the MILS system went live on a new catalog system,
> Polaris.
> https://mils.polarislibrary.com
>
> As part of this move, there is a temporary disruption to both MaineCat
> activity and to Reciprocal
> Borrowing.
>
> MaineCat and Reciprocal borrowing requests, checkouts, etc. that were
> submitted prior to our migration are being handled as they always have, and
> can be completed with no change in work-flow from non-MILS libraries in
> MaineCat.  Existing loans both to and from MILS libraries will work their
> way through the system to completion without disruption.
>
> At this current time, no NEW MaineCat or Reciprocal Borrowing requests or
> checkouts can be made by or from MILS libraries.
>
> Over the next few weeks the MILS libraries will be first decontributed from
> MaineCat, then reloaded completely. Once that work is done and tests have
> been run, requesting to and from MILS libraries through MaineCat and
> Delivery will be restored.
>
> Unfortunately, Reciprocal Borrowing (Walk-in-borrowing, visiting patron,
> etc.) functionality between MILS and other MaineCat Libraries will not be
> available until early December as this is completely new functionality for
> Polaris/INN-Reach connections (we are working to make it happen sooner and
> may move that date up if testing goes well).
